Step Onto The Glass Walkway

Get ready for a thrilling adventure as you step onto the Glass Walkway of Tower Bridge! Suspended 42 metres above the River Thames, this see-through floor offers an unforgettable view of the bustling city below!

Imagine the excitement as your kids spot red double-decker buses and boats sailing beneath their feet. Don’t forget to bring your camera - this is the perfect spot for some amazing family photos and maybe even a playful game of “spot the landmark!”

Visit The Tower Bridge Exhibition

Dive into the fascinating history of Tower Bridge with the Tower Bridge Exhibition! This interactive experience is designed to engage both kids and adults with fun displays and hands-on activities. Your family can explore the Victorian Engine Rooms, learn how the bridge was built, and even try their hand at raising the bridge themselves with interactive models.

Admire The Spectacular Bridge Lifts

Witnessing a bridge lift at Tower Bridge is a truly magical experience for the whole family. With more than 850 lifts a year, there's a good chance you'll see the giant bascules rise to allow tall ships and boats to pass through. Check the bridge lift schedule to plan your visit around this exciting event.

Transport Information

By Tube

Take the Circle or District Line to Tower Hill Station. From the station, it's a short 10-minute walk to Tower Bridge. Follow signs towards the Tower of London, then cross the bridge for breathtaking views and easy access.

By Train

If you're travelling by train, head to London Bridge Station. From there, it’s about a 15-minute walk. Exit the station and follow the signs for Tooley Street, then walk east along the riverbank until you reach Tower Bridge.

By Bus

Several buses stop near Tower Bridge. Take bus numbers 15, 42, 78, 100, or 343 to Tower Bridge Road. These buses will drop you within a short walking distance of the bridge. Follow the signs to the bridge, and you’ll be there in no time!
